Extraction protocol Foxp3-positive and CD4-positive T cells were FACS-sorted from wild-type NOD mice. Single cells were diluted to 1000 cells /ul in 0.04% BSA/PBS
Chromium Single-cell 3’ RNA-Seq library (v1) generation was carried according to 10X Genomics protocols
 
Library strategy RNA-Seq
Library source transcriptomic
Library selection cDNA
Instrument model Illumina NextSeq 500
 
Description gene expression of single nuclear transferred T cells
Data processing Data processing: The Cell Ranger Single Cell Software Suite v1.3 was used to perform sample demultiplexing, barcode processing, and single cell 3' gene counting (https://support.10xgenomics.com/single-cell/software/pipelines/latest/what-is-cell-ranger). Cell Ranger commands used to produce this aggregated dataset:
cellranger count (--cells=3000 ...)
cellranger aggr --id=AGG001 --csv=cellranger-aggregation.csv --normalize=mapped
Genome_build: mm10
Supplementary_files_format_and_content: Tab-deliminated text file of matrix table containing normalized expression values (UMI/cell). Each row corresponds to a gene and each column corresponds to an individual cell.
